Why it matters

The problem this solves.

High-volume applications create a volume problem that does not have a human solution at the speed the market requires. A recruiter processing 80 applications for a single role has, on average, fewer than four minutes per CV if they want to turn around a longlist within 24 hours. At that speed, screening becomes pattern-matching against a mental checklist — and strong candidates who do not fit the pattern get filtered out before anyone reads their application properly.

Structured AI screening changes the quality of the decision, not just the speed. It reads every CV against the same criteria with the same attention — flagging strengths and gaps based on what the role actually requires, not what is easiest to spot in a quick scan. The result is a more defensible shortlist and a better use of recruiter time on the candidates that genuinely warrant it.

In practice

How recruiters use CV / Application Screener.

A healthcare recruiter processing 60 applications for a community nursing role uses the screener to produce structured summaries in under an hour — identifying the top twelve for telephone screening and flagging three risk cases for specific questions.
An in-house TA manager uses the screener output as the first step in a structured shortlisting process — requiring the AI summary to be reviewed by a recruiter before any candidate is rejected, ensuring no strong candidate is eliminated on a quick scan.
A solo recruiter sends the shareable summary to a hiring manager for early-stage sign-off — reducing the number of shortlisted candidates who are rejected at the first manager review.

Questions

Common questions about CV / Application Screener.

Does it replace human judgment?
No — it accelerates it. The screener provides a structured analysis that helps you focus your attention where it matters most. The hiring decision remains yours.
How many CVs can I screen in one session?
The tool screens one CV at a time against a specified role. For high-volume screening, run CVs through sequentially. The Solo Recruiter plan includes 40 screens per month.
Does it make hiring decisions?
No. The screener provides a structured assessment that informs your shortlisting — it does not make or recommend a hiring decision. All decisions remain with the recruiter and hiring manager.
